Hot synthesis gas from a melamine synthesis reactor containing substantially all the melamine product is contacted with a melt of urea at 150 C or above, as a result of which the melamine becomes suspended in the melt to the extent of 5-50% by weight thereof. The melamine is then suitably separated from the melt by centrifuging, the crystals of melamine washed with water, and the urea melt passed back to the melamine synthesis reactor. The reactor is operated at relatively low pressure, e.g. 7 atmospheres.
